Mimix™ Geni™ Negative FFPE Reference Standard - The Mimix™ Geni™ Negative FFPE Reference Standard is a commutable control material comprising a formalin-fixed paraffin-embedded (FFPE) curl derived from the GM24385 Genome-in-a-Bottle Consortium (GIAB) cell line, with no additional genomic interventions. It is intended for qualitative and/or quantitative monitoring of next generation sequencing (NGS) and droplet digital polymerase chain reaction (ddPCR) assays designed to detect somatic oncogenic mutations and gene fusions in genomic DNA (gDNA) or RNA from human samples for in vitro diagnostic use. The gDNA or RNA obtained from Mimix Geni Negative FFPE Reference Standard can be used to monitor NGS or ddPCR workflows, test performance, assay variation and helps identify increases in random or systematic errors. This product is for professional laboratory use only.

Mimix™ Geni™ OncoMix 1 DNA/RNA FFPE Reference Standard - The Mimix™ Geni™ OncoMix 1 DNA/RNA FFPE Reference Standard is a commutable control material comprising a formalin-fixed paraffin-embedded (FFPE) curl made from a multiplex of 7 engineered cell lines from the GM24385 Genome in a Bottle Consortium Cell line (GIAB), containing 5 single nucleotide polymorphisms (SNPs) and 2 gene fusions. It is intended for quantitative and/or qualitative monitoring of next-generation sequencing (NGS) or droplet digital polymerase chain reaction (ddPCR) assays designed to detect somatic mutations and gene fusions in genomic DNA (gDNA) or RNA from human samples for in vitro diagnostic use. The gDNA or RNA obtained from Geni OncoMix 1 DNA/RNA FFPE Reference Standard can be used to monitor NGS or ddPCR workflows, test performance, assay variation and helps identify increases in random or systematic errors. This product is for professional laboratory use only.

Mimix™ OncoSpan gDNA Reference Standard - The Mimix™ OncoSpan gDNA reference standard is a commutable control material comprising a mixture of genomic DNA (gDNA) derived from human cancer cell lines, containing more than 380 variants across 152 cancer genes. It is intended for qualitative and/or quantitative monitoring of next-generation sequencing (NGS) and droplet digital polymerase chain reaction (ddPCR) assays designed to detect somatic mutations in human gDNA samples for in vitro diagnostic use. This control can be used to monitor NGS and ddPCR workflow, test performance, assay variation and helps identify increases in random or systematic errors. This product is for professional laboratory use only.
